This volume brings together ten influential articles from Harvard Business Review that examine the strategic, managerial, and organizational implications of artificial intelligence. The selected essays explore how AI is reshaping decision-making, operations, leadership, and competitive advantage across industries. Topics include integrating AI into core business processes, managing human–machine collaboration, addressing ethical and governance challenges, and building organizational capabilities for AI-driven transformation. Written by leading scholars and practitioners, the collection provides practical frameworks and real-world case studies to help managers understand how to deploy AI responsibly while maintaining human judgment, trust, and long-term value creation
